Why will the motor on my rainbow power on if I hold it up off of the water basin and push the safety switch with a screwdriver but when it's sitting on the water basin it won't power on ?

There is a little tab that sticks up on the water basin, this tab pushes in on the switch allowing the unit to run, I'm guessing the little tab on the tank is broken off.

Rainbow vacuum is spraying water onto floor

This is usuallly one of two things. Crack in water basin. And the seperator underneath needs to be taken off and cleaned with a tooth brus between each of its fins. Their are alot of fins dont miss one.

Rainbow Vacuum, about 5 yrs old (bought new, no issues prior) - my 6yr old tipped it on it's side while water was in basin. Now when I turn the power on, it makes a very loud sound in the motor and you can...

Although a wet/dry vacuum, it cannot tolerate water in the motor. Water will cause the motor to short out, which will cause the motor to act/sound like yours does now, if it continues working at all.
To prevent additional problems, the vacuum needs to be taken to an authorized Rexair dealer for cleaning and repair. Expect at the very least to pay for a new motor and installation.
Problems like this are why I don't care for any wet/dry vacuums, especially spendy ones.
Oh, you should definitely discontinue use, and don't attempt repairs on your own. Special tools are needed, and if bolts and screw are rusted, breakage may result.

Shampooer will not work on my e2 Rainbow. Help!

Your Rainbow E series has lost suction power, because you need a new hepa filter, or your water basin gasket is messed up, or the center motor gasket is messed up or out of position.

Make sure your water basin is not cracked or broken, also.
If it is an earlier model, everything applies, except for the filter. They do not have filters, on any of the earlier models.

My e series rainbow smells very badly... my teenager often leaves the water in for days and that nasty smell has saturated the sweeper itself. How do I get the smell out

You should always put a new hepa filter in any E and E2 series Rainbow vacuum, when it taken to a new home, or every two Years, or so, or if your Doughter makes it get funky smelling. :-) It will smell like the home that it was in, or how ever it smells, until you do.

You can also use fragrances, and deodorizer air freshener in your vacuum, which not only eliminates odors, it add fresh aromas to your air that you breath, in your home, also.

Replace the hepa filter first thing.

The water separator is the thing that spins in the center of the motor where your water basin attaches to it. It looks like a cone shaped fan looking thing. It should be cleaned after every use.

Use your Rainbow separator cleaning brush, or a tooth brush, if you do not have the Rainbow one. They are just like tooth brushes.


Never store your Rainbow canister on your water basin, with or without water in it. It can and will ruin your vacuum in dew time.

Rainbow e2 system. Will not power up

the water basin has a safety on it so the unit cannot run without it. if you look on the bottom of the rainbow you can see a small oval shaped space that you can depress just to test and see if it still runs it will only run with this depressed.
